The Lagos State Government has sealed the Ladipo Spare Parts Market located along Apapa-Oshodi road over alleged environmental infractions.
The Lagos State Commissioner of Environment and Water Resources, Tokunbo Wahab, announced this via a post on X on Sunday, February 8, 2026.

Wahab wrote: “Lagos State government, this morning, sealed Ladipo Spare Parts Market along Murtala Muhammed International Airport Road (Apapa–Oshodi Expressway) over repeated environmental infractions; indiscriminate refuse disposal on the median/highway and illegal street trading.”
